Artificial Intelligence for Development (AI4D)

Artificial Intelligence for Development (AI4D) is a programme that aims to foster safe, inclusive and responsible AI ecosystems that empower people and accelerate progress on challenges in international development. AI4D supports responsible AI ecosystems where experts in developing countries are enabled to develop their own solutions to development challenges and mitigate AI risks through safe, inclusive, rights-based and sustainable AI applications and policies.

Launched initially as ‘AI4D Africa’ in 2020, the first phase of the programme laid a solid foundation by supporting responsible AI policies, multidisciplinary research, and innovative projects across the African continent. Building on this success, AI4D entered its second phase in 2024, with a broadened scope that now spans Africa and Asia, supported by a partnership between the UK’s Foreign Commonwealth and Development Office (FCDO) and Canada’s International Development Research Centre (IDRC), and additional funding from Swedish SIDA.
